defloresco
Latin edit
Etymology edit
Pronunciation edit
- (Classical) IPA(key): /deː.floːˈreːs.koː/, [d̪eːfɫ̪oːˈreːs̠koː]
- (modern Italianate Ecclesiastical) IPA(key): /de.floˈres.ko/, [d̪efloˈrɛsko]
Verb edit
dēflōrēscō (present infinitive dēflōrēscere, perfect active dēflōruī); third conjugation, no passive, no supine stem
